Project in Java Skill Tree

在目录中搜索文本文件

Beginner

在本项目中,你将学习如何使用 Java 在目录中搜索文本文件。该项目将指导你完成从用户获取输入路径、验证输入、查找目录中的所有文本文件并打印其名称的过程。

Java

💡 本教程由 AI 辅助翻译自英文原版。如需查看原文,您可以 切换至英文原版

简介

在这个项目中,你将学习如何使用Java在目录中搜索文本文件。本项目将指导你完成从用户获取输入路径、验证输入、查找目录中的所有文本文件以及打印其名称的过程。

👀 预览

请输入读取路径:/home/labex/project/files
找到的文本文件:
file1.txt
file3.txt
file6.txt

🎯 任务

在这个项目中,你将学习:

  • 如何使用Scanner类获取用户输入的目录路径
  • 如何使用File类验证输入路径
  • 如何创建自定义的FilenameFilter来过滤文本文件
  • 如何使用listFiles()方法在目录中找到所有文本文件
  • 如何遍历找到的文本文件并打印其名称

🏆 成果

完成本项目后,你将能够:

  • 使用Scanner类获取用户输入的目录路径
  • 使用File类验证输入路径
  • 实现自定义的FilenameFilter来过滤文本文件
  • 利用listFiles()方法检索目录中的所有文本文件
  • 遍历找到的文本文件并打印其名称

教师

labby

Labby

Labby is the LabEx teacher.